You're reading: Rada extends law on special local self-government in separatist-held Donbas for a year

The Verkhovna Rada of Ukraine has extended for a year the validity of the law on a special order of local self-government in certain regions of the Donetsk and Luhansk regions (ORDLO), which was to become inoperative on Oct. 18.

The corresponding law on the creation of the necessary conditions for the peaceful settlement of the situation in certain regions of the Donetsk and Luhansk regions (No. 7164) was supported by 229 people’s deputies at the plenary session on Oct. 6, an Interfax-Ukraine agency correspondent reported.
